    Ys Origin is a prequel to the previous nine installments of the Ys video game series. It takes place 700 years before the events of Ys I: Ancient Ys Vanished, and tells much of the backstory of Ys, Darm Tower, the Black Pearl, the twin goddesses, and the six priests. The game has three playable characters: Yunica Tovah, Hugo Fact, and Toal Fact.

    Ys Seven [b] is a 2009 action role-playing game developed by Nihon Falcom. An installment in the Ys series , it was first released in Japan for the PlayStation Portable in September 2009. Xseed Games released the game in 2010 in North America in August, [ 2 ] [ 3 ] and Europe in November.

    Ys (イース, Īsu, ) / iː s / is a Japanese role-playing video game series and one of Nihon Falcom's flagship franchises. [1] The series started on the PC-8801 in 1987. The games take place in a fictional world with some geographical resemblance to Earth , and chronicle the adventures of Adol Christin, a red-haired swordsman, and his companions.

    Ys: The Oath in Felghana [1] is a 2005 action role-playing game developed by Nihon Falcom. A part of the Ys series , it is a remake of Ys III: Wanderers from Ys (1990). The Oath in Felghana was first released for Windows in Japan in June 2005, with an English localization by Xseed Games in March 2012.
